Subject[PATCH bpf-next v2] bpf: update bpf_get_smp_processor_id() documentation
Date
From: Matteo Croce <mcroce@microsoft.com>

BPF programs run with migration disabled regardless of preemption, as
they are protected by migrate_disable().
Update the documentation accordingly.

* u32 bpf_get_smp_processor_id(void)
* Description
* Get the SMP (symmetric multiprocessing) processor id. Note that
- * all programs run with preemption disabled, which means that the
+ * all programs run with migration disabled, which means that the
* SMP processor id is stable during all the execution of the
* program.
